Let's explore the different types of rings that might be relevant, focusing on materials, design, and purpose. Rings have been used throughout history as symbols of commitment, status, and belonging. When we consider materials, we might think of gold, silver, platinum, and more contemporary options like titanium or even wood. Design-wise, the possibilities are endless. From simple bands to intricate settings with precious stones, the design of a ring reflects personal style and often carries symbolic meaning. The purpose of a ring can also vary. Engagement rings symbolize a promise of marriage, while class rings commemorate academic achievement. Signet rings, often bearing a family crest, were historically used to seal documents. Caring for Your Rings
Proper care is essential to maintain the beauty and longevity of your rings. Clean your rings regularly with a soft cloth and mild soap. Avoid exposing your rings to harsh chemicals, such as chlorine bleach, which can damage the metal and gemstones. When you're not wearing your rings, store them in a jewelry box or pouch to protect them from scratches and tarnish. If your rings contain gemstones, consider having them professionally cleaned and inspected periodically. This will help ensure that the stones are securely set and free from damage. Different metals and gemstones require different care techniques, so it's essential to research the specific needs of your rings. For example, silver rings are prone to tarnishing and may require regular polishing. Gold rings can be cleaned with a mild jewelry cleaner and a soft brush. Gemstones like diamonds can be cleaned with warm water and a gentle soap. By following these simple care tips, you can keep your rings looking their best for years to come.
